How the Inventory Turnover Ratio Calculator formula works
The core formula behind the Inventory Turnover Ratio Calculator is based on average inventory. Average inventory is typically calculated by adding beginning inventory and ending inventory, then dividing by two.
Formula:
(cost of goods sold / ((beginning inventory + ending inventory) / 2)) * (period_days / period_days)
Because (period_days / period_days) simplifies to 1, the formula effectively becomes:
Cost of Goods Sold / Average Inventory
Here is what each part means:
- Cost of Goods Sold (COGS) = the direct cost of items sold during the period
- Beginning Inventory = inventory value at the start of the period
- Ending Inventory = inventory value at the end of the period
- Average Inventory = (Beginning Inventory + Ending Inventory) / 2
The result is the Turnover Ratio. For example, if a company has $200,000 in COGS and average inventory of $50,000, the turnover ratio is 4.0. That means the business sold and replaced its inventory roughly four times during the period.
Why average inventory matters: inventory levels can change throughout a month or year, so using only beginning or ending inventory may not reflect the true picture. Average inventory gives a more balanced view of stock usage.
In some cases, businesses also use the ratio to estimate days in inventory. While the result label here is Turnover Ratio, understanding the time equivalent can help interpret the number more clearly. In general:
- Higher turnover = inventory moves faster
- Lower turnover = inventory moves slower
Use cases for the Inventory Turnover Ratio Calculator
The Inventory Turnover Ratio Calculator is useful in many business scenarios. Whether you operate a small shop or a large distribution network, this ratio can guide purchasing, pricing, and inventory planning.
- Retail businesses: Track how quickly products sell on the shelf and identify slow-moving items.
- eCommerce stores: Measure how effectively online inventory converts into sales.
- Manufacturers: Monitor raw materials, work-in-progress, and finished goods management.
- Wholesalers: Evaluate stock flow across large product catalogs and regional distribution.
- Financial analysis: Compare operational efficiency across periods or against industry benchmarks.
Here are a few practical examples of how the calculator can help:
- Seasonal planning: Determine whether holiday stock is selling at the expected pace.
- Reordering decisions: Avoid overbuying inventory that turns slowly.
- Cash flow management: Reduce money tied up in excess stock.
- Performance benchmarking: Compare product lines or store locations.
Example use case: A clothing retailer notices that winter coats have a lower turnover ratio than t-shirts. That insight can lead to deeper discounts, better demand forecasting, or more cautious purchasing next season.
Other factors to consider when calculating Turnover Ratio
While the Inventory Turnover Ratio Calculator is a powerful tool, the result should always be interpreted in context. A “good” turnover ratio depends on the industry, product type, and business strategy.
Consider these important factors:
- Industry norms: Grocery stores often have much higher turnover than luxury goods retailers.
- Seasonality: Inventory turnover may rise or fall depending on the time of year.
- Product shelf life: Perishable goods typically require faster movement than durable items.
- Promotions and pricing: Discounts can boost turnover temporarily.
- Supply chain issues: Delays can distort inventory levels and ratios.
- Accounting method: Valuation methods such as FIFO or weighted average may affect reported figures.
Also remember that a very high turnover ratio is not always ideal. In some cases, it may indicate that inventory levels are too low, increasing the risk of stockouts and missed sales. On the other hand, a very low ratio may signal too much capital tied up in inventory, which can raise holding costs and increase the risk of obsolescence.
Best practice: Use this ratio alongside other metrics such as gross margin, sell-through rate, and stockout rate for a fuller view of inventory health.
FAQ
What is inventory turnover ratio?
Inventory turnover ratio measures how many times a business sells and replaces inventory during a specific period. It is a key indicator of inventory efficiency and sales performance.
What does a high turnover ratio mean?
A high turnover ratio usually means inventory is moving quickly. This can be a positive sign, but if the ratio is extremely high, it may also suggest understocking or frequent stock shortages.
Can I use this calculator for monthly, quarterly, or yearly periods?
Yes. The Inventory Turnover Ratio Calculator can be used for different accounting periods as long as your COGS and inventory values match the same time frame.
Why is average inventory used in the formula?
Average inventory gives a more accurate picture than using only beginning or ending inventory because stock levels can change throughout the period.
Is inventory turnover ratio the same as days in inventory?
No, but they are closely related. Inventory turnover ratio shows how often inventory is replaced, while days in inventory estimates how long inventory sits before being sold.
